Problem2088--字符串mama

2088: 字符串mama

Time Limit: 1 Sec  Memory Limit: 128 MB
Submit: 552  Solved: 367
[Status] [Submit] [Creator:]

Description

给定一个仅包含小写英文字母的字符串 s,从字符串中取出一些字符组成尽可能多的 "mama"。

举个例子:  

比如有一个字符串 "mmmbcdefgaa",则最多可以从中取出两个字符 'm' 和两个字符 'a' 组成一个字符串 "mama";  

又比如有一个字符串 "abababababmmmmmmmmmmmmmmmmmm",则最多可以从中取出 4 个字符 'm' 和 4 个字符 'a' 组成两个字符串 "mama"。

求,从字符串中取出一些字符能够组成的 "mama" 的最多数量。

Input

一行字符串 s,s 仅由小写英文字母组成且长度不超过 10^5 。

Output

输出一个整数,表示从字符串 s 中取出一些字符能够组成的最多的 "mama" 的数量。

Sample Input Copy

【样例输入1】
aaaammmm
【样例输出1】
2
【样例输入2】
aaaaammmmmbcdefghijklmn
【样例输出2】
2
【样例输入3】
aammm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mmm
【样例输出3】
1

HINT

数据规模与约定:
设 |s| 为字符串 s 的长度,则
· 对于30%的数据,|s|≤100
· 对于60%的数据,|s|≤1000
· 对于100%的数据,1≤|s|≤10^5

Source/Category